Summary

When a young archaeologist disappears during a dig at Whitby Abbey, so begins a terrifying and sinister chain of events. As an eerie fog settles over the town and more disappearances are reported, young ghost hunters Eve, Clovis and Tom find themselves involved in a terrifying case.

Could it be that the ghost of Vlad the Impaler has come to the seaside town? And can they stop the rise of his demonic vampire army?

Author Biography

Yvette Fielding was the youngest ever Blue Peter presenter at age 18, and she's since gone on to host and produce Ghosthunting With... and Most Haunted. After years of studying ghosts, she's become television's 'first lady' of the paranormal. She lives with her husband, fellow ghost hunter Karl, in the UK.
